When you are giving a match everything you have, the last thing you want is your feet sliding around inside your boots. Whether you are chasing the winning goal or holding down the back line, stability and comfort change how you play.

If you have noticed more players wearing grip socks and wondered whether they actually work, the answer is yes. Here are the ten benefits that matter, and why they apply whether you play once a week or train every day.

1. Traction Inside Your Boots

This is the big one. Rubberized or silicone patterns on the sole create friction between your foot and the inside of your cleat, preventing internal slippage during quick cuts, turns, and sprints. You focus on outplaying your opponent instead of readjusting your feet.

2. Improved Agility and Reaction

With your foot held securely in place, you stop losing milliseconds to sliding inside your boots. That means faster pivots, cleaner direction changes, and more explosive acceleration, exactly what you need to beat a defender or close down an attacker.

3. Better Balance

So much of soccer happens on one foot: striking the ball, shielding it, landing after a header. When your plant foot is not sliding inside the boot, your balance improves in every one of those moments, and you stay in control of both the ball and your body.

4. Fewer Blisters

Blisters come from movement between your foot, your sock, and your cleat. Grip socks cut that motion down with a second-skin fit that keeps the foot locked in place, so the friction that causes hotspots never builds up.

5. A Confidence Boost

There is a mental side to this too. When you feel locked in, you go harder into tackles, take on defenders, and stay aggressive late in the match. For younger and developing players especially, that confidence shows up in the way they play.

7. Works With Any Cleat

No special shoes required. Grip socks replace your regular athletic socks and work with any standard soccer cleat, whatever brand you play in. You will notice the difference the first session.

8. Durability That Outlasts the Season

Well-made grip socks hold their shape and grip long after standard athletic socks give out. Look for silicone grip fused into the knit rather than glued-on pods that peel after a few washes, and a reinforced toe and sole where boots wear socks down first. That is exactly how the SL PRO is built.
